What Wall-Thickness Tolerance Costs on a Carbon Steel Square and Rectangular Steel Tube Order
Tight tolerance directly determines whether a structural frame passes load calculation or fails inspection.
When buyers source ASTM A106 Carbon Steel Square and Rectangular Steel Tube from fragmented suppliers, wall thickness often drifts beyond acceptable limits. A batch labeled 2.0mm may arrive at 1.7mm — the theoretical weight looks correct on paper, but the actual load-bearing capacity drops, and third-party inspection flags the discrepancy. In Mexico, I once saw an entire container of seamless tubes rejected at the port because the client’s independent lab found negative tolerance eating into the minimum wall requirement. Understanding Carbon Steel Grades and ERW Welding Process for Hollow Sections
The Q195–Q690 carbon steel grade range covers everything from light-duty furniture frames (Q195/Q215) to heavy structural columns (Q355/Q460). Higher grade numbers indicate increased yield strength, allowing thinner walls to carry equivalent loads — but only if tolerance is controlled. The ERW hot-rolled process forms the tube from hot-rolled coil, then welds the seam under pressure. Unlike seamless manufacturing, ERW offers tighter dimensional consistency at lower cost for non-pressure applications. Surface treatment choice depends on environment: black finish suits indoor structural use, hot-dip galvanizing (Z10–Z29) protects outdoor fencing and scaffolding, while PVC coating or color painting serves architectural applications where appearance matters. Each option preserves the underlying steel grade’s mechanical properties while adding environmental resistance.
